Throughout human history, bracelets have served as more than mere adornments. These circular wrist ornaments carry deep cultural symbolism and profound meanings across civilizations, acting as silent storytellers of heritage, status, and spiritual beliefs. Let's explore how different cultures imbue bracelets with unique significance.

Ancient Egypt: Divine Protection & Eternal Life

The ancient Egyptians wore beaded bracelets featuring lapis lazuli and carnelian, believing these stones offered protection in the afterlife. Gold cuff bracelets shaped like coiled serpents symbolized eternal life, while turquoise represented joy and healing. Hindu & Buddhist Traditions: Energy Alignment

In South Asian cultures, rudraksha seed bracelets are worn for meditation and spiritual grounding. Tibetan Buddhists use mani beads for prayer rituals, with 108-bead malas representing cosmic order. Native American Culture: Connection to Earth

Southwestern tribes craft silver and turquoise bracelets honoring Earth's spirits. Turquoise symbolizes wisdom and protection, while woven leather bracelets represent life's interconnectedness. African Traditions: Community & Identity

Maasai warriors' intricately beaded bracelets communicate social status and age sets. Cowrie shell bracelets in West Africa historically represented prosperity and feminine energy. Thick bronze "manilla" bracelets were both currency and marital symbols in some regions.
